To begin, it's important to understand how oral health can directly affect our self-esteem. Poor oral hygiene can lead to issues such as bad breath, tooth decay, and gum disease. These conditions not only impact our physical health, but they can also cause embarrassment and self-consciousness. For example, someone with bad breath may feel self-conscious about speaking or being in close proximity to others.

Similarly, someone with visible tooth decay may feel insecure about their appearance and avoid smiling or social situations. This can have a negative impact on their confidence and overall self-esteem.On the other hand, maintaining good oral hygiene can help boost self-esteem. A healthy mouth can give us confidence in our appearance and allow us to feel more comfortable in social situations. Additionally, practicing good oral hygiene can also prevent more serious dental issues down the line, which can help alleviate anxiety and worry surrounding our dental health. So what steps can we take to improve our oral hygiene and in turn, boost our self-esteem? Firstly, it's important to establish a good daily dental routine.

This should include brushing twice a day with a fluoride toothpaste, flossing at least once a day, and using mouthwash. It's also recommended to visit the dentist for regular check-ups and cleanings to catch any potential issues early on. Another key aspect of maintaining good oral health is watching what we eat and drink. A diet high in sugary and acidic foods can contribute to tooth decay and gum disease. It's important to limit these types of foods and instead opt for a well-balanced diet that includes plenty of fruits, vegetables, and calcium-rich foods.In addition to our daily routine, there are also some practical tips for caring for our teeth and gums.

These include using a soft-bristled toothbrush, brushing gently in circular motions, and replacing our toothbrush every 3-4 months or when the bristles become frayed. It's also important to pay attention to our oral health during times of stress or illness, as these can have a direct impact on our immune system and dental health. By following these tips, we can improve our oral hygiene and in turn, boost our self-esteem. Remember, our oral health is an important aspect of our overall well-being, and taking care of it can have a positive impact on our confidence and self-image. The Connection Between Oral Health and Self-Esteem

The state of our oral health has a significant impact on our self-esteem, as it can affect both our physical appearance and our overall sense of well-being. Poor oral hygiene can lead to a host of dental issues, from cavities and gum disease to bad breath and tooth loss. These problems can not only cause physical discomfort but also make us feel self-conscious about our smile and appearance. When we have poor oral health, we may avoid smiling or talking in public, which can negatively affect our confidence and self-esteem. We may also feel embarrassed or ashamed about the state of our teeth and gums, which can lead to social anxiety and avoidance of social situations. Furthermore, poor oral hygiene can also impact our mental health.

Studies have shown that individuals with poor oral health are more likely to experience feelings of depression, anxiety, and low self-esteem compared to those with good oral hygiene. This is because the condition of our teeth and gums can affect our ability to eat, speak, and even sleep comfortably, leading to feelings of frustration, helplessness, and inadequacy. It is crucial to understand the connection between oral health and self-esteem so that we can take steps to improve our oral hygiene and overall well-being. By maintaining good oral health habits, such as brushing twice a day, flossing daily, and visiting the dentist regularly, we can prevent dental issues and maintain a healthy smile. This, in turn, can boost our self-confidence and improve our self-esteem.
